Has Anyone Got Any Good Homemade Dog Food Recipes
raw chicken carcass or chicken wings, or raw lamb offcuts bones and meat from the supermarket or butcher will take care of his teeth and calcium if you are worried about it. What Kaz says I do up a big pot now and again with pasta and vegies and either homemade mince or mince from the butchers. Butchers mince here is $2-3 a bag and contains meat fat and liver etc. Puts the condition on my working dogs well. Other than that they get good quality bikkies and meat on the bone I like to give pups lamb brisket or ribcage when teething, they use the front and rear teeth on them. Lovebirds?
No do not keep them with anything else, they live perfectly happy with each other but even 1 lovebird with other species can cause a fair bit of damage without trying hard. They breed happily in a large aviary without as many problems that the budgies do. Space, good size nestboxes (not too big, not too small) but enough room for them to have a clutch of chicks and also fill it with nesting material When you are set-up, supply them with palm fronds (date/cotton are okay) long grasses etc anything they can shred up and weave into tunnels inside the nestbox I found this stimulates some breeding. Mine fill the nests with any vegetables, grasses, green pick that I give them to eat also so have to keep an eye on that sometimes Once they start breeding you are right but same as other birds its getting them to feel right. Mine went near 4 yrs without then all of a sudden the population tripled. Ive mainly blue series masked, some green and others all masked.
